Brave, valiant, or one who comforts
Derived from Swahili and Arabic roots, the name often signifies strength and courage. In some contexts, it is also associated with the act of comforting or mending. It gained popularity in the United States during the late 20th century as a name celebrating African heritage.
About 172 boys were named Jabari in 2025.
